„SNMP Trap Receivers

Up to four SNMP management stations can be specified. If you want to use SNMP trap notifications, do the following:

1.Check Enable SNMP Trap.

2.Select which version of SNMP you want to use.

3.Key in the IP address(es) and the service port number(s) of the computer(s) to be notified of SNMP trap events. The valid port range is 1–65535. The default port number is 162.

Note: Make sure that the port number you specify here matches the port number used by the SNMP receiver computer.

4.Key in the community value(s) if required for the SNMP version.

5.Key in the auth/privacy password(s) that correspond to each of the stations.
